    I was notified that in my header image, when viewed in IE, there is a red x at top of image. It doesn't show in Firefox. Does anyone know where I should look for the prob?
    I searched the forums but didn't find any results. cheers, Laurie

    if you validate your site using the W3c validator:

    http://validator.w3.org/check?uri=http://www.leehane.ca/weblog/

    It explains whats wrong with the image in your header in the first cpl lines.

    For starters, you didnt enclose the path to the image in complete quotes:

    <img class="center" src=images/headmast1.jpg/>

    AND

    you've placed the self-closing tag in the wrong "place"

    it ought to look like this:

    <img class="center" src="images/headmast1.jpg" />
